Key Legal Requirements for Licensing Agricultural Machinery
The legal requirements for licensing agricultural machinery are designed to ensure safety, compliance, and environmental standards. These requirements typically specify the documents and certifications needed to obtain licensing.
Applicants must submit a completed application form, proof of ownership or leasing agreement, and evidence of compliance with safety and emissions standards. Additionally, certain machinery may need to meet specific technical specifications set by regulatory authorities.
Importantly, applicants are often required to provide proof of relevant safety certifications issued by accredited testing agencies. Compliance with environmental regulations may also necessitate environmental impact assessments or emissions testing reports.
Failure to meet key legal requirements can result in licensing denial or sanctions. These requirements are regularly updated to reflect technological advances and safety considerations within the framework of agricultural regulation law.

Safety Standards and Inspection Protocols for Licensed Machinery
Safety standards and inspection protocols for licensed agricultural machinery are vital components ensuring operational safety and regulatory compliance. These standards typically mandate that machinery undergo regular inspections to verify adherence to established safety requirements. Inspection protocols involve evaluating critical aspects such as braking systems, safety guards, emission controls, and electrical systems to prevent accidents and environmental hazards.
In many jurisdictions, machinery must pass initial and periodic safety inspections conducted by authorized regulatory agencies. These inspections confirm that the machinery maintains proper safety certifications and remains compliant with the applicable agricultural regulation law. Failing to meet these safety standards can lead to legal penalties, including fines or suspension of licensing. Regular maintenance and inspections are emphasized as preventive measures to minimize mechanical failures and ensure continuous safety compliance.
The enforcement of safety standards and inspection protocols reflects the legal commitment to protecting operators, nearby communities, and the environment. Compliance with inspection requirements often involves documentation, certification renewals, and adherence to updated regulations. These protocols aim to foster a safer agricultural environment while aligning with broader legal frameworks governing agricultural machinery licensing laws.

Inspection and Maintenance Procedures
Inspection and maintenance procedures are critical components of agricultural machinery licensing laws, ensuring that machinery remains safe and compliant. Regular inspections verify that machinery meets safety standards and functional requirements mandated by regulatory authorities within the Agricultural Regulation Law. These inspections typically include checking safety features, operational efficiency, and emission levels, depending on the machinery type.
Periodic maintenance is equally essential and involves routine tasks such as lubrication, parts replacement, and system calibrations. Proper maintenance prolongs machinery lifespan and reduces the risk of malfunction or accidents, aligning with legal safety standards. Operators are usually required to keep detailed records of inspections and repairs to demonstrate compliance during audits or inspections by regulatory bodies.
Compliance with inspection and maintenance protocols usually requires certified safety certifications, which confirm that machinery meets the prescribed legal standards. Strict adherence to these procedures is enforced through scheduled inspections and unannounced spot checks, maintaining high safety and efficiency standards under the Agricultural Machinery Licensing Laws.
